Join author, coach, and organisational psychologist Michelle Minnikin as she unpacks and challenges the 'Good Girl' narrative that limits women in their personal and professional lives. In each episode, explore the stories, strategies, and psychology behind breaking free from social conditioning, reclaiming authenticity, and thriving on your own terms.       It’s been a while… and we’re back.

      In the first episode of 2026, Michelle is joined by educator, tutor, author and business owner Caroline Bowmer – her co-author on Good Girl Deprogramming – Girl’s Edition and the accompanying Caregiver Guide.


      This honest, funny, and deeply grounded conversation explores what it really means to grow up as a “good girl,” why perfectionism starts so young, and how we can support girls aged 10–14 to trust themselves before self-doubt takes hold.


      Together, Michelle and Caroline talk about teenage brains, school pressure, fear of failure, people-pleasing, and why adolescence isn’t a problem to fix – it’s a vital transformation to protect.


      This episode is for parents, carers, educators, and anyone who wants the next generation of girls to grow up freer than we did.

      In this episode we explore

      • Why “being good” can quietly damage girls’ self-worth

      • How teenage behaviour is communication, not defiance

      • The importance of supporting trusted adults alongside girls

      • Why self-love is the foundation of confidence and autonomy

      • How to reduce pressure without removing care or standards

      Alex is a Captain of Be More Pirate, a book turned social movement and home for professional rule breaking (look out for season 3 of our podcast coming soon...)

      Alex is author of How to: Be More Pirate, a speaker, facilitator, and a coach for women. For the past four years she has delved into the world of good girl conditioning with Pass the Mic; a speaking programme designed to help women find and own their voice.

      Steph Edusei is the Chief Executive of St Oswald’s Hospice, a large children and adults charitable hospice. She’s also a Director of the North East Chamber of Commerce.

      As an integral part of her local community, Steph has been a leader with Girlguiding UK for over 30 years and holds the position of Chair at Eliot Smith Dance Company. Previously, she served as a Non-Executive Director of The Newcastle upon Tyne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ust and was the co-chair of The Angelou Centre, a Black-led women's charity offering training, counselling, and refuge support.

      Steph is the founder of the ‘Black All Year’ podcast and associated events. She uses the platform to amplify black voices, highlight the challenges faced by Black people, and celebrate their successes and achievements.

      In 2022, Steph was named Transformational Leader at the Northern Power Women Awards.

      In 2024, Steph was named on the BusinessCloud Northern Leaders list and in 2025 Steph was added to the prestigious Northern Power Women Power List.
